With Camp Washington as our classroom, Wave Pool’s summer camp offers creative adventures for the young urban explorer.

We’ll use art and music to envision our dream neighborhood as we explore landmarks in our own. Join camp counselors Dana Hamblen and Julia Lipovsky for visits to the American Sign Museum, CampSITE Sculpture Park, Mom n Em, the Swing House, and, of course, Wave Pool and The Welcome Project. Campers will unlock a sense of possibility as they use their imaginations to navigate our beloved Camp Washington.
Dana Hamblen has lived in Camp Washington for 14 years. She is a drummer and bassist for multiple bands in Cincinnati and has the most enviable collection of props and clothing from her time running the vintage shop Chicken Lays and Egg.
Julia Lipovsky has lived in Camp Washington since 2016 and has taught inclusive arts programs for Visionaries + Voices, the Contemporary Arts Center, Kennedy Heights Arts Center, and Camp cARTwheel.
Dates: August 9-13
Time: 9 am - 3 pm
Ages: 6 - 10
Campers are expected to pack their lunch.
